History and Significance

The championship boasts a rich history, dating back to 1927 when it was first held. Over the decades, it has evolved, adapting to changing times while retaining its core values of excellence and sportsmanship. The Crucible Theatre in Sheffield, England, has been its home since 1977, adding to the event's unique atmosphere and iconic status. This venue has witnessed countless dramatic moments and has become synonymous with the championship itself. The Crucible’s intimate setting creates an intense atmosphere, amplifying the pressure on the players and adding to the excitement for the viewers. Many legends of the game have graced its stage, and their performances have contributed to the tournament's enduring legacy. Dates and Schedule

The World Snooker Championship typically takes place in April and May. The tournament spans over two weeks, featuring multiple rounds of intense competition. Here’s a general idea of how the schedule unfolds:

  • First Round: Featuring 32 players, this round sets the stage for the rest of the tournament.
  • Second Round: The winners from the first round battle it out to advance further.
  • Quarter-Finals: The competition intensifies as the remaining players vie for a spot in the semi-finals.
  • Semi-Finals: This is where the stakes get incredibly high, with players just one step away from the final.
  • Final: A two-day showdown between the two best players in the tournament, culminating in the crowning of the World Champion.

Memorable Moments in Snooker History

Throughout its history, the World Snooker Championship has produced numerous memorable moments that have captivated audiences worldwide. These moments range from stunning comebacks and unexpected upsets to record-breaking performances and displays of exceptional sportsmanship. One such moment occurred in 1985 when Dennis Taylor defeated Steve Davis in a thrilling final that went down to the very last ball. Another unforgettable moment was Ronnie O'Sullivan's record-breaking 147 maximum break in just five minutes and 20 seconds in 1997. These moments, and countless others, have contributed to the championship's rich legacy and continue to inspire new generations of snooker players and fans.
